         The Bybee Babes wish to thank everyone for their support in the benefit for Ms.Denise Davenport. That was held at the Bruners Grove Grocery Store, in BrunersGrove, on Labor day, Monday, September 1st. The Hand made quilt known as "Tea ForThose Who Have None" was raffled off by ticket sales with 100% of the proceedsfor Ms. Denise Davenport to continue her missionary work in South Africa. Thewinner of the "Tea For Those Who Have None" quilt was Ms. Diane Spoone, fromMorristown, Tn., who volunteers at Noah's Arc Animal Rescue.
